How to Get a private adhd assessment wales cost Adult ADHD Assessment

Being diagnosed with ADHD can be difficult especially for adults. Many healthcare professionals aren't aware of how to recognize ADHD in adults or only have a limited set of diagnostic tools.

Using self-assessment tools may provide some clues, however a valid diagnosis can only be determined by a trained professional. This includes clinical psychologists, physicians (psychiatrist or neurologist) and medical social workers.

What is an assessment that is private?

top-doctors-logo.pngPeople who suspect that they suffer from ADHD may seek private healthcare to get an assessment and prescription for medication. It is crucial to remember that only psychiatrists with a specialization and experience working with ADHD in adult patients are able to diagnose ADHD. Mental health professionals and counselors can discuss ADHD symptoms but they are unable to give a formal diagnosis.

The primary method for diagnosing ADHD is a structured clinical interview and questionnaires. These are usually based on research that compares behaviours of people suffering from ADHD with those of people who are not. During the evaluation it is crucial for the individual to be honest and transparent and not hold back details or conceal any difficulties they face. The doctor will inquire with the patient about the severity and frequency of symptoms in various situations and over time. They will also discuss the family history, as well as any other mental problems or drug and/or alcohol use.

A psychiatrist will evaluate the symptoms and their impact on daily life. It is usually more thorough than a standard psychiatric examination It is therefore important to book ahead and allow plenty of time for the appointment. Bring a family member or a friend to offer assistance and feedback. Sometimes additional psychological, learning disabilities, or neuropsychological testing is used in conjunction with the clinical assessment to determine if ADHD is present, or if any other disorders are contributing to the symptoms.

After the assessment the doctor will let the person know what the next steps are. Typically they will discuss if medication is needed and will agree on an overall treatment plan. Some clinics offer a quick stabilisation and titration program for those who want to start taking medication straight from the beginning. This service is usually only available to a limited number of clients who meet certain criteria that include being over 18 and not having a pre-existing medical condition that could prevent them from taking their treatment immediately (e.g. hyperthyroidism or symptomatic cardiovascular illness).

What happens during the time of a private adhd assessment isle of wight Assessment?

While every doctor has their own evaluation process but there are certain processes that all doctors consider essential for a comprehensive ADHD evaluation. These include a thorough diagnostic interview, data gathered from sources other than the doctor (such as spouses and family members), standardized behavior rating scales for ADHD and other forms of psychometric tests determined appropriate by the physician.

The diagnostic interview is usually the initial step in the process. The person being assessed will be asked several questions that are designed to make them consider the ways they've been behaving and to discuss how those behaviors influence their lives. This will take an hour or more. It is crucial to get a full and honest response from the patient or family member. Some patients may be embarrassed or hesitant to talk about their behavior, which can affect the quality of your evaluation.

During the interview, the examiner will ask questions about the effects of ADHD on the person's relationships as well as their life. They will also ask about the person's medical history and how long they have been experiencing symptoms of ADHD. This is an important aspect of the assessment because it will help determine whether a diagnosis of ADHD is appropriate.

At the end of the interview the examiner will fill out some standard behavioral rating scales for ADHD. These scales are based on research that compares the behaviors of people with ADHD to those of people who do not have ADHD and are a significant source of information objective. Typically, the person being evaluated and their significant other will complete these rating scales together.

A thorough ADHD evaluation can be conducted face-to-face or online. The clinician will interview you, review relevant medical history and may suggest psychometric testing to better understand your cognitive capabilities. These tests typically include standardized behavioural rating scales for ADHD psychometrics that cover a broad spectrum and tests of specific abilities.

The doctor will utilize all the information gathered from various sources to form a diagnosis of ADHD and other psychiatric or learning disorders that were identified during the assessment. The physician will be able to discuss the options for treatment with you and assist you to create a comprehensive plan that may include medication, therapy or other psychosocial interventions.

Once a final diagnosis has been made and the clinician has written an extensive report that will be provided to you and your GP. The doctor will provide your GP all the documentation necessary for you to be able to receive prescription medication through the NHS. You will be required to attend follow up appointments with your GP to allow them to keep track of your progress and verify that the medications are working.
